Kathmandu, 15 April: Minister for Culture, Tourism and Civil Aviation Rabindra Adhikari has allegedly reduced the rent of cargo warehouse without any reason. National Janamanch vernacular weekly, in today's edition reports that minister Adhikari reduced the rent of the warehouse situated at the Tribhuvan International Airport immediately after assuming the office. It was the first meeting of Civil Aviation Authority of Nepal (CAAN) chaired by minister Adhikri that decided to lessen the rent amount. Acting upon the request of businessmen, the minster decided in favor of them further weakening the condition of financially feeble warehouse. People's News Monitoring Service
